For many year's we've been supporting charities through fundraising and volunteering, but this summer we're launching something new and we're really excited!
Side by Side is our first ever joint member and employee volunteering project. It gives members and employees the opportunity to work together to support their local communities by giving up their valuable time. The Side by Side project is launching on the 19th of May in Bournemouth and will run for two weeks, supporting the four following charity projects:
BCHA - The charity provides a range of support services for socially excluded people in Bournemouth including learning and work programmes, outreach and rehabilitation. Our volunteers will be helping to design and deliver a workshop to help the charities service users with employability.
James Burns House - The charity is a residential care home for physically disabled adults. Our volunteers will be rejuvenating a garden area for the residents to enjoy, and taking part in the house's social activities during the day.
Victoria Education Centre - The charity is a residential and day school which offers specialised care and therapy for disabled young people. Our volunteers will be helping to create a pets corner area suitable for wheelchair users, and clear a memorial area, a place a where student can use for quiet reflection.
Autism Wessex - The charity supports children, young people and adults with autism to live independent lives. They run a specialist school for children and residential homes for adults. Our volunteers will be repainting and refurbishing areas of the school to improve the environment.
